In today's business environment, understanding the various components that contribute to a company's overall expenses is crucial for effective financial management. One such component is the administration cost, which refers to the expenses incurred in the general administration of a business rather than the production of goods or services. These costs can include salaries of administrative staff, office supplies, utilities, and other overheads that support the overall operations of a company. The significance of administration cost cannot be overstated. For many organizations, especially small businesses, these costs can represent a substantial portion of their total expenditures. Therefore, it is essential for business owners and managers to keep a close eye on these expenses to ensure they do not spiral out of control. By analyzing and managing administration cost, companies can identify areas where they can cut back or optimize their spending, ultimately leading to improved profitability.One way to effectively manage administration cost is through the implementation of technology. Many businesses are turning to software solutions that automate administrative tasks, such as payroll processing, accounting, and inventory management. By reducing the time spent on these tasks, companies can lower their administration cost while also increasing efficiency. Furthermore, cloud-based solutions allow businesses to minimize physical office space, which can also lead to significant savings in terms of rent and utilities.Another important aspect to consider is the role of employee training and development in controlling administration cost. Investing in training programs can enhance the skills of administrative staff, leading to increased productivity and reduced errors. When employees are well-trained, they can perform their tasks more efficiently, which in turn lowers the overall administration cost. Additionally, a well-trained workforce is likely to have higher job satisfaction, leading to lower turnover rates and associated recruitment costs.Moreover, businesses should regularly review their administration cost structures. This can involve conducting audits to assess where money is being spent and whether those expenses are justified. By identifying unnecessary or redundant costs, companies can streamline their operations and allocate resources more effectively. For instance, if an organization finds that certain subscriptions or services are underutilized, they can eliminate those expenses and redirect funds towards more productive areas.In conclusion, administration cost plays a vital role in the financial health of any organization. By understanding what constitutes these costs and actively seeking ways to manage them, businesses can improve their bottom line. Through the use of technology, employee training, and regular reviews, companies can ensure that their administration cost remains manageable, allowing them to focus on growth and innovation. Ultimately, effective management of administration cost not only enhances operational efficiency but also contributes significantly to the overall success of the organization.
